Major Grocery Store Chains
Cooper Sharp cheese is frequently stocked by large supermarket chains across the United States. These retailers often carry it in their cheese or deli sections, making it accessible for everyday shopping.
- Walmart: Most Walmart stores have Cooper Sharp cheese available in their refrigerated dairy sections. It is often sold in blocks or pre-sliced packages.
- Kroger: Kroger and its affiliated stores (such as Fred Meyer, King Soopers, and Ralphs) typically stock Cooper Sharp cheese, both in-store and online.
- Safeway/Albertsons: These chains regularly include Cooper Sharp cheese in their cheese selections. Check for availability in larger or flagship stores.
- Costco: Some Costco locations carry Cooper Sharp cheese, usually in larger bulk packages suited for families or food service.
